Partager via


ActivityTrackingRecord Classe

Définition

Attention

The System.Workflow.* types are deprecated. Instead, please use the new types from System.Activities.*

Contient les données envoyées à un service de suivi par l'infrastructure de suivi d'exécution lorsqu'un ActivityTrackPoint est mis en correspondance. Il est également utilisé dans la liste de retour de la propriété ActivityEvents.

public ref class ActivityTrackingRecord : System::Workflow::Runtime::Tracking::TrackingRecord
public class ActivityTrackingRecord : System.Workflow.Runtime.Tracking.TrackingRecord
[System.Obsolete("The System.Workflow.* types are deprecated.  Instead, please use the new types from System.Activities.*")]
public class ActivityTrackingRecord : System.Workflow.Runtime.Tracking.TrackingRecord
type ActivityTrackingRecord = class
    inherit TrackingRecord
[<System.Obsolete("The System.Workflow.* types are deprecated.  Instead, please use the new types from System.Activities.*")>]
type ActivityTrackingRecord = class
    inherit TrackingRecord
Public Class ActivityTrackingRecord
Inherits TrackingRecord
Héritage
ActivityTrackingRecord
Attributs

Remarques

Notes

Ce document décrit les types et les espaces de noms qui sont obsolètes. Pour plus d’informations, consultez Types dépréciés dans Windows Workflow Foundation 4.5.

Lorsque l'infrastructure de suivi d'exécution fait correspondre un ActivityTrackPoint dans un TrackingProfile, elle envoie un ActivityTrackingRecord au service de suivi sur le TrackingChannel associé à ce service de suivi. Le service de suivi peut exécuter toute action nécessaire sur les données dans l'enregistrement de suivi.

Constructeurs

ActivityTrackingRecord()

Initialise une nouvelle instance de la classe ActivityTrackingRecord.

ActivityTrackingRecord(Type, String, Guid, Guid, ActivityExecutionStatus, DateTime, Int32, EventArgs)

Initialise une nouvelle instance de la classe ActivityTrackingRecord en utilisant les paramètres spécifiés.

Propriétés

ActivityType

Obtient ou définit le type de common language runtime (CLR) de l'activité associée à ce ActivityTrackingRecord.

Annotations

Obtient la collection d'annotations associée au ActivityTrackPoint pour lequel une correspondance a été établie.

Body

Obtient une liste qui contient toutes les données extraites du workflow pour le ActivityTrackPoint qui a été mis en correspondance.

ContextGuid

Contexte de l'activité.

EventArgs

Toujours null pour un ActivityTrackingRecord.

EventDateTime

Obtient ou définit la date et l'heure auxquelles l'événement de statut d'activité a eu lieu.

EventOrder

Obtient ou définit une valeur qui indique l'ordre dans l'instance de workflow de l'événement de statut d'activité qui a correspondu au ActivityTrackPoint.

ExecutionStatus

Obtient ou définit l'état d'exécution de l'activité associée à ce ActivityTrackingRecord.

ParentContextGuid

Contexte de l'activité parente.

QualifiedName

Obtient ou définit l'identificateur de l'activité associée à ce ActivityTrackingRecord.

Méthodes

Equals(Object)

Détermine si l'objet spécifié est égal à l'objet actuel.

(Hérité de Object)
GetHashCode()

Fait office de fonction de hachage par défaut.

(Hérité de Object)
GetType()

Obtient le Type de l'instance actuelle.

(Hérité de Object)
MemberwiseClone()

Crée une copie superficielle du Object actuel.

(Hérité de Object)
ToString()

Retourne une chaîne qui représente l'objet actuel.

(Hérité de Object)

S’applique à